Abstract

Summary: Multi-mapping sequence tags are a significant impediment to short-read sequencing platforms. These tags are routinely omitted from further analysis, leading to experimental bias and reduced coverage. Here, we present MuMRescueLite, a low-resource requirement version of the MuMRescue software that has been used by several next generation sequencing projects to probabilistically reincorporate multi-mapping tags into mapped short read data. © The Author 2009.
